The Real Risks of Buying an eBay Account

Purchasing an eBay account might look like an easy win, but it can lead to serious issues.

1. Account Suspension

eBay strictly prohibits account transfers. If the platform detects unusual activity, mismatched IPs, or new ownership, the account can be suspended permanently — along with your funds.

2. Scams and Fraud

Many sellers offering eBay accounts are not genuine. Buyers often lose money or receive accounts that are banned or restricted soon after purchase.

3. Legal and Ethical Concerns

Selling or transferring accounts violates eBay’s Terms of Service. This can cause not only financial loss but also damage to your brand reputation.

4. No Real Ownership

Even if you get the login, the original owner can reclaim the account at any time by resetting credentials or contacting eBay support. You could lose everything overnight.

Safer Alternatives to Buying eBay Accounts

If your goal is to grow a successful eBay business, there are better and safer ways to do it.

✅ 1. Build Your Own Verified Account

Create a new eBay business account and verify your details. This ensures full control and long-term growth.

✅ 2. Start Small, Scale Smart

List a few buy ebay account products, offer fast shipping, and provide great customer service. Positive feedback will come quickly when you’re consistent.

✅ 3. Use eBay Seller Tools

eBay offers growth tools like Promoted Listings, Seller Hub Analytics, and Performance Reports. Use them to boost visibility and credibility.

✅ 4. Partner with Legitimate Sellers

If you need experience or guidance, collaborate with an established eBay seller or hire a store management agency. It’s compliant and risk-free.
